Lose your HEAD over this superbly strange soundtrack. The three-disc boxed set that features 21 previously unreleased tracks, outtakes, rarities, and live performances, plus an entire disc containing a rare interview with Jones recorded in 1968 for radio broadcast.
The first disc's bonus tracks present alternate stereo mixes for nearly every song, except "Can You Dig It" which is featured as a rough stereo mix with Tork singing instead of Dolenz, and "Daddy's Song" which is remixed with a section that was never originally used in the film or soundtrack album.
Disc two is dedicated to outtakes and rarities, including mono mixes for every track along with unreleased mono movie mixes for "Can You Dig It" and "Daddy's Song." The unreleased gems include an alternate version of "Ditty Diego", "War Chant," plus, "California, Here It Comes," a song heard briefly in 1969 playing over the credits of The Monkees' television special 33? Revolutions Per Monkee. The disc also includes a rare live set from the Valley Music Hall in Salt Lake City from the spring of 1968. The performances were recorded for the film, but ultimately only one track ("Circle Sky") was used. The unreleased live tracks from this set include the Headquarters-era gems "You Just May Be The One," "Sunny Girlfriend," and "You Told Me."
The final disc contains a rare radio interview with Jones about the album that was issued in 1968 by Colgems as a promotional LP. This material was captured from the original vinyl and adds to the rarity of this collector's item. The disc also includes full tracks and excerpts from the HEAD soundtrack that were interspersed throughout the interview. Deluxe booklet features new liner notes by Andrew Sandoval and Rachel Lichtman highlighted by brand-new interviews with Michael Nesmith and director Bob Rafelson about Head, in addition to dozens of unpublished color photos.

Passed on from babysitters to their young charges, from big sisters to little brothers, and from parents to children, Tales of a Fourth Grade Nothing and its cousins (Superfudge, Fudge-a-mania, and Otherwise Known as Sheila the Great) have entertained children since they first appeared in the early 1970s. The books follow Peter Hatcher, his little brother Fudgie, baby sister Tootsie, their neighbor Sheila Tubman, various pets, and minor characters through New York City and on treks to suburbs and camps. Tales of a Fourth Grade Nothing is the first of these entertaining yarns. Peter, because he's the oldest, must deal with Fudgie's disgusting cuteness, his constant meddling with Peter's stuff, and other grave offenses, one of which is almost too much to bear. All these incidents are presented with the unfailing ear and big-hearted humor of the masterful Judy Blume. Though some of her books for older kids have aroused controversy, the Hatcher brothers and their adventures remain above the fray, where they belong. (Peter's in fourth grade, so the book is suitable for kids ages 8 and older.)

If you are leading a non government organization you would certainly want to get more publicity because non government organizations depend heavily on charities and donations they receive from various individuals and companies. There may be many volunteers working under your organization but you still need to push a little extra to get more publicity. You can certainly contact some ad maker and request them to make an advertisement for your organization that is fighting for a cause, but instead of doing that you can make use of promotional items and see how it can get your organization more coverage.
The biggest asset that every NGO has is the volunteers that work for that particular organization. If you have more than hundred volunteers you can make use of all those hundred people and get more publicity that you would never get with advertisements. Here is the list of some promotional items that you can use to earn some publicity from your volunteers.
Awareness Bracelets - It does sound very simple and cheap but awareness bracelets can become promotional items if you really think out of the box. These awareness bracelets are becoming very common these days as they are made from silicone and they really last long. You can print the logo of your NGO on it and give it to all your volunteers and even to people who donate and participate in your organization activities. When you buy these bracelets in bulk they will hardly cost your organization and you will be surprised to see the response.
Awareness Stickers - Stickers are simple, cheap and really effective promotional items and therefore you can make use of awareness stickers to get your organization some coverage. You can distribute the bunch of stickers to all your volunteers and request them to spread it out among the people they interact with. You can stick those awareness stickers on cabs and buses in the city and see how quickly people know about your non government organization.
Awareness Magnets - They are almost like stickers but work differently. Awareness magnets are easily available everywhere and you can give it to your volunteers and people who participate in making your organization a success. There are many dealers and suppliers that deal in custom printed awareness magnets and therefore you can make your own design or request the dealer to come up with some exciting one liner that talk about the cause your organization is fighting for.

5 Things You Never Thought You Could Do With Posters
Think you know everything there is to know about poster printing? You may know about the proper colors, the good dimensions and the most effective paper materials.
However, there are a few effects that are just a little bit out of the realm of regular poster printing. In this article, I will give you five things you never thought you could do with your color posters. Hopefully this can give you a lot of new ideas about how you manage your poster designs in the future.
1. Adding twinkles and glitters – Have you ever heard about color posters twinkle or glitter? Well they are not then usual kinds but there are those color posters that do exhibit this feature. This is possible because of their printing inks, or it can be a built-in feature of the paper material. Whatever the technique, the addition of twinkling or glittering elements can really add a magical element to the design. It is really a remarkable feature that most people do not know can be done. You can try this feature out for your more festive ads especially during the holidays.
2. Adding 3D effects and holograms – Now, you may have seen 3D effects or holographic effects in a lot of stickers and other types of small printed materials. You should know that you could also place the same interesting features on a color poster. While this can be an expensive kind of printing project, placing 3D effects and holograms can really make a design quite unique and memorable. It is something that can really market an idea if you can implement it well. You should check this out if you want to try something wild.
3. Adding holes or making different shapes – Who says posters need to be rectangle shaped. Some people can actually get fixated with standard rectangle dimensions. However, what you may not know is that you can actually make different shapes other than the usual rectangle. You can customize a poster in any shape you like.
In fact, you can put in holes, and cut a lot of different forms to make them look quite interesting. Just ask your poster printer if they can do this. They should be able to give you a quotation for printing which might be a bit expensive, but really unique and original in a lot of ways.
4. Adding optical illusions – Have you seen those special optical illusions that some puzzles have? It can be an image hidden in scribbles, or text and pictures that have a very different meaning when viewed in a certain way. Plenty of special printed optical illusions can add to an advantageous design. If you want to puzzle and interest the minds of your readers, you might want to try out this technique as well.
5. Adding scents – Finally, if we have scented papers and folders, why not scented color posters? There is some memory retention involved in smelling as well as seeing. Adding the right kind of smell in your ads can really make it quite noticeable and memorable. So if at all possible, you should try adding some scents to the paper of the poster to make it quite memorable for some people. It is subtle but it works.
Therefore, if you are fresh out of ideas for promotional poster printing you should try the ideas mentioned. It might prove to be very interesting.
